我用一些愚蠢的伎俩严重损坏了我的 Debian。我现在正在尝试使用 Live CD 修复它,mount
在 HDD 上安装系统,然后chroot
使用 aptitude 进入系统来修复它。
我能够修复我的 aptitude 问题,但chroot
ed 系统无法连接到网络。
我的想法是从 live CD 系统下载 aptitude 的 deb 包并将apt-get download
其复制到ed 系统中/var/cache/apt/archives
以供chroot
查找。
如何导出所有需要从 aptitude 下载的包?
编辑根据要求:这是愚蠢的特技:
我正在将 i386 安装转换为 amd64,在此过程中,我同时安装了很多 amd64 软件包并一次性卸载了 i386 软件包。这导致一些基本命令在系统上不再可用,并且 amd64 软件包未配置。
我可以从 Live CD 安装 HDD,使用ar x package_amd64.deb
、 和解压文件tar -xf data.tar.xz
,然后将生成的文件夹复制到 HDD 以继续。